@font-face{font-family:'neuropolmedium';src:url(logo-font/neuropol-webfont.woff2) format('woff2') , url(logo-font/neuropol-webfont.woff) format('woff');font-weight:normal;font-style:normal}.clear{clear:both}.hero-start-link,.fet_pr-carousel-box-media-zoom,.box-media-zoom{z-index:999}.mar-bottom{margin-bottom:20px}.hidden,.form-submit .submit{display:none}.comment-form textarea,.comment-form input[type="text"],.comment-form input[type="email"],.comment-form input[type="password"],.wpcf7 textarea,.wpcf7 input[type="text"],.wpcf7 input[type="email"],.wpcf7 input[type="password"],.wpcf7 input[type="tel"]{float:left;border:none;border:1px solid #eee;background:#fff;width:100%;padding:15px 20px;color:#666;font-size:12px;-webkit-appearance:none}.comment-form input::-webkit-input-placeholder,.comment-form textarea::-webkit-input-placeholder,.wpcf7 input::-webkit-input-placeholder,.wpcf7 textarea::-webkit-input-placeholder,.wpcf7 input[type="tel"]::-webkit-input-placeholder{color:#888da0;font-weight:600;font-size:12px;position:relative}.comment-form input:-moz-placeholder,.comment-form textarea:-moz-placeholder,.wpcf7 input:-moz-placeholder,.wpcf7 textarea:-moz-placeholder,.wpcf7 input[type="tel"]:-moz-placeholder{color:#888da0;font-weight:600;font-size:13px}.comment-form textarea,.wpcf7 textarea{height:200px;resize:none;padding:25px 30px;-webkit-appearance:none;border:1px solid #eee}.comment-form input,.wpcf7 input{margin-bottom:20px}.comment-form button,.wpcf7 input[type="submit"]{padding:0 85px 0 45px;outline:none;border:none;cursor:pointer;-webkit-appearance:none;height:44px;line-height:44px;float:left;position:relative;color:#fff;font-size:10px;text-transform:uppercase;letter-spacing:2px;font-weight:400;margin:25px 0 15px}.wpcf7 input[type="submit"]{padding:0 45px;border-right:44px solid;border-color:#2a2a2e}.comment-form button i{position:absolute;right:0;width:44px;height:44px;line-height:44px;background:#2a2a2e;top:0}.wpcf7 label{text-align:left;color:#666;width:100%;font-size:13px;float:left;font-weight:600}.comment-notes,.logged-in-as{padding:25px 0}.logged-in-as{font-size:14px;font-weight:600}.logged-in header.main-header,.logged-in .fixed-column-wrap-content{top:32px}.blog-page-temp-side .pagination,.index-blog-template .pagination{margin:20px 0 0}.blog-page-temp-side .pagination .container,.index-blog-template .pagination .container{width:100%}.widget li{float:left;width:100%;padding-bottom:8px;margin-bottom:15px;text-align:left;position:relative}.widget_categories li:before,.widget_archive li:before{content:'';position:absolute;bottom:6px;width:100px;height:1px;background:#eee;left:50%;margin-left:-25px}.widget.widget_archive li,.widget.widget_categories li{text-align:right}.widget.widget_recent_comments li{text-align:left}.widget_recent_comments span{float:none!important}.widget_recent_comments a{float:none!important}.widget li:nth-last-child(1){margin-bottom:0}.widget li a{float:left;font-size:12px;color:#292929;font-weight:800}.widget a{font-size:10px;-webkit-transition:all 200ms linear;transition:all 200ms linear}.vc-section{position:relative;width:100%;float:left}.vc-section .section-number.right_sn{top:-10px}.page-section-separator{width:100%;max-width:100%}.wpb_text_column{margin-bottom:0!important}.vc_element_text{font-size:12px;line-height:24px;font-weight:500;color:#5e646a;text-align:left}.inline-facts-wrap,.team-box{width:100%}.team-box{padding:0 0 0 0}.policy-box p{float:left;color:rgba(255,255,255,.41);font-size:10px;font-weight:400;text-transform:uppercase;letter-spacing:2px;line-height:90px;padding-bottom:0}.error-search-wrap h3{font-size:26px;text-align:center;text-transform:uppercase;color:#000;font-weight:800;float:left;width:100%;letter-spacing:2px;padding-bottom:10px;line-height:34px}.error-search-wrap form input{background:#f9f9f9;border:1px solid #eee}.error-search-wrap p{color:#000}.widget_tag_cloud a{float:left;text-align:center;padding:15px 30px;margin-right:2px;color:#fff;background:#35353a;font-weight:800;margin-bottom:4px;font-size:10px!important;-webkit-transition:all 200ms linear;transition:all 200ms linear}.widget_tag_cloud a:hover{color:#ccc}.footer-widget p{font-family:'Roboto',sans-serif;color:rgba(255,255,255,.41)}.widget .footer-header{margin-bottom:55px}.footer-widget li:before{display:none}.footer-widget li{text-align:left;color:rgba(255,255,255,.41);font-size:12px;letter-spacing:2px;text-transform:uppercase;padding-bottom:10px}.footer-widget li a{color:rgba(255,255,255,.81)}.mc4wp-form{position:relative;width:100%;float:left}.footer-widget .mc4wp-form{margin-top:40px}.mc4wp-form input[type="text"],.mc4wp-form input[type="email"]{margin-top:42px}.mc4wp-form input[type="text"],.mc4wp-form input[type="email"]{float:left;width:100%;border:none;background:bottom;padding:15px 100px 15px 0;position:relative;z-index:1;color:#fff;border-bottom:1px solid rgba(255,255,255,.21)}.mc4wp-form input[type="text"]::-webkit-input-placeholder,.mc4wp-form input[type="email"]::-webkit-input-placeholder{color:#fff;font-weight:400;font-size:12px}.mc4wp-form input[type="submit"],.mc4wp-form button{position:absolute;bottom:15px;right:0;width:100px;z-index:2;color:#fff;background:none;border:none;cursor:pointer;text-align:right;text-transform:uppercase;font-size:10px;letter-spacing:2px}.mc4wp-form button i{padding-left:10px}.widget .mc4wp-form input[type="submit"],.widget .mc4wp-form button{color:#000}.widget .mc4wp-form input[type="text"],.widget .mc4wp-form input[type="email"]{border-bottom:1px solid #000;color:#000}.widget .mc4wp-form input[type="text"]::-webkit-input-placeholder,.widget .mc4wp-form input[type="email"]::-webkit-input-placeholder{color:#000}.header-logo h1{font-size:25px;color:#fff;font-family:'Oswald',sans-serif;text-transform:uppercase;line-height:29px}@media only screen and (min-width:768px){.two-ver-columns .portfolio_item .grid-item-holder{max-width:349px}}div.wpcf7-validation-errors,div.wpcf7-acceptance-missing,div.wpcf7-mail-sent-ok{border:none;text-align:left;float:left;width:100%}span.wpcf7-not-valid-tip{float:left;text-align:left;padding-bottom:20px}div.wpcf7 .ajax-loader{margin:38px 0 0 15px}.horizonral-subtitle span{border:none}@media only screen and (max-width:768px){.half-hero-wrap h4{font-size:16px;max-width:350px}}@media only screen and (max-width:410px){.nav-scroll-bar-wrap{padding:50px 40px 100px 100px}.nav-social{padding:0 20px 0 121px}.half-hero-wrap h1,.hero-section .section-title h2,.hero-title .section-title h2{font-size:30px}.half-hero-wrap h4{font-size:15px}}.comment-title-area.crunchify-text{float:left;margin-right:10px}#cancel-comment-reply-link{color:#000}#cancel-comment-reply-link:before{content:"/";padding-right:10px}.comment #respond{margin-top:40px;float:left;width:100%}.woocommerce .loader::before{background-image:none}.woocommerce .woocommerce-result-count,.woocommerce-page .woocommerce-result-count{text-align:left;font-size:11px;text-transform:uppercase;letter-spacing:2px;font-weight:bold;color:#000}.woocommerce .woocommerce-ordering select{height:45px;margin-bottom:17px;position:relative;top:-13px;border:1px solid #f8f8f8;padding:0 10px;letter-spacing:2px;font-weight:bold}.woocommerce ul.products li.product .woocommerce-loop-category__title,.woocommerce ul.products li.product .woocommerce-loop-product__title,.woocommerce ul.products li.product h3,.woocommerce div.product .product_title{text-align:left;width:100%;padding-bottom:10px;font-weight:600;font-size:16px}.woocommerce ul.products li.product .price,.woocommerce div.product p.price,.woocommerce div.product span.price{font-size:12px;letter-spacing:2px;color:#666;text-align:left;font-weight:600;text-transform:uppercase}.woocommerce #respond input#submit,.woocommerce a.button,.woocommerce button.button,.woocommerce input.button{border-radius:0;padding:0 85px 0 45px;outline:none;border:none;cursor:pointer;-webkit-appearance:none;height:44px;line-height:44px;float:left;position:relative;color:#fff!important;font-size:10px;text-transform:uppercase;letter-spacing:2px;font-weight:400;margin:25px 0 15px}.woocommerce #respond input#submit i,.woocommerce a.button i,.woocommerce button.button i,.woocommerce input.button i{position:absolute;right:0;width:44px;height:44px;line-height:44px;background:#2a2a2e;top:0;text-align:center}.woocommerce ul.products li.product .star-rating{font-size:.857em;margin-bottom:12px}.woocommerce ul.products li.product a{display:block}.product_meta{text-align:left;font-size:11px;text-transform:uppercase;letter-spacing:2px;font-weight:bold;color:#000}.product_meta span.sku,.product_meta a{font-weight:400}.woocommerce span.onsale{height:40px;width:40px;background-color:#000}.woo-tab-content{float:left;width:100%}#tab-description{display:block}.woocommerce #reviews #comments h2,.related.products h2,.cart-empty,.cart_totals h2,.woocommerce-billing-fields h3,.woocommerce-additional-fields h3{font-size:22px;text-align:left;color:#000;font-weight:800;float:left;width:100%;padding-bottom:20px;line-height:34px}.related.products{background:transparent;padding-bottom:0}.woocommerce .quantity .qty{width:41px;height:33px;text-align:center;padding-left:14px}.woocommerce div.product form.cart .group_table td.woocommerce-grouped-product-list-item__label,.woocommerce div.product form.cart .group_table td{line-height:31px}.simple-pro-th .single_add_to_cart_button,.variations_button .single_add_to_cart_button{margin-top:0!important}.simple-pro-th .quantity .qty,.variations_button .quantity .qty{height:44px!important}.simple-pro-th{margin-top:10px}table.variations select{height:45px;margin-bottom:17px;position:relative;border:1px solid #f8f8f8;padding:0 10px;letter-spacing:2px;font-weight:bold}.woocommerce #respond input#submit.disabled,.woocommerce #respond input#submit:disabled,.woocommerce #respond input#submit:disabled[disabled],.woocommerce a.button.disabled,.woocommerce a.button:disabled,.woocommerce a.button:disabled[disabled],.woocommerce button.button.disabled,.woocommerce button.button:disabled,.woocommerce button.button:disabled[disabled],.woocommerce input.button.disabled,.woocommerce input.button:disabled,.woocommerce input.button:disabled[disabled],.variations_button button{padding:0 85px 0 45px}.woocommerce-Reviews #reply-title{border:none;text-align:left}.woocommerce #review_form #respond p.stars{text-align:center}.comment-form-rating{margin-top:15px}.comment-form-rating .rating{font-weight:bold}.woocommerce #review_form #respond .form-submit input#submit,.woocommerce .coupon button.button{padding:0 45px 0 45px}.woocommerce-notices-wrapper{position:relative;top:-40px}.woocommerce .woocommerce-error .button,.woocommerce .woocommerce-info .button,.woocommerce .woocommerce-message .button,.woocommerce-page .woocommerce-error .button,.woocommerce-page .woocommerce-info .button,.woocommerce-page .woocommerce-message .button,.woocommerce-cart-form__contents button,.checkout_coupon button{padding:0 45px 0 45px!important;margin-top:10px}.woocommerce #payment #place_order,.woocommerce-page #payment #place_order{padding:0 45px 0 45px!important}.woocommerce-error,.woocommerce-info,.woocommerce-message{line-height:66px}.woocommerce .woocommerce-cart-form table.shop_table{margin-bottom:10px;border-collapse:collapse;border-width:0;width:100%}.woocommerce-cart-form .shop_table thead{background:transparent;border-bottom:1px solid #e8e8e8}.woocommerce table.shop_table th,.woocommerce .shop_table thead th.box-name{font-size:12px;text-transform:uppercase;border-left:0;color:#292929}.woocommerce-cart-form .shop_table tbody tr td{padding:15px 10px;vertical-align:top;border:none!important;font-size:12px;text-transform:uppercase;border-left:0;color:#292929}.shop_table tbody tr .product-remove a{position:relative;font-size:18px;line-height:23px;padding:0 7px 0 6px;width:21px;height:21px;border-radius:100%;background-color:#000;color:#fff!important;-webkit-transition:background-color .3s ease;-moz-transition:background-color .3s ease;transition:background-color .3s ease}.shop_table tbody tr .product-remove a:hover{background:#000}.woocommerce-cart-form .shop_table tbody tr .product-thumbnail img{width:80px;height:80px}.woocommerce-cart-form .variation p{line-height:19px}#add_payment_method table.cart td.actions .coupon .input-text,.woocommerce-cart table.cart td.actions .coupon .input-text,.woocommerce-checkout table.cart td.actions .coupon .input-text{height:44px;width:140px}.woocommerce .coupon button.button,.woocommerce-cart-form__contents button,.checkout_coupon button{margin-top:0!important;margin-bottom:0!important}.woocommerce-page table.cart td.actions{padding:30px 25px;border:1px solid #e8e8e8!important}#add_payment_method .wc-proceed-to-checkout a.checkout-button,.woocommerce-cart .wc-proceed-to-checkout a.checkout-button,.woocommerce-checkout .wc-proceed-to-checkout a.checkout-button{border-radius:0;padding:0 45px 0 45px;outline:none;border:none;cursor:pointer;-webkit-appearance:none;height:44px;line-height:44px;float:left;position:relative;color:#fff!important;font-size:10px;text-transform:uppercase;letter-spacing:2px;font-weight:400;margin:25px 0 15px}.woocommerce .cart-collaterals .cart_totals,.woocommerce-page .cart-collaterals .cart_totals{margin-top:35px}.woocommerce form .form-row input.input-text,.woocommerce form .form-row textarea{float:left;border:none;border:1px solid #eee;background:#fff;width:100%;margin-bottom:20px;padding:15px 20px 15px 20px;color:#666;font-size:12px;-webkit-appearance:none}.woocommerce form .form-row textarea{height:150px}.woocommerce-form-coupon-toggle{text-align:left}.swatchtitlelabel{font-weight:700;text-transform:capitalize;color:#5e646a}@media only screen and (max-width:640px){.start-btn.hero-start,.home-half-slider .start-btn{display:block}}@media only screen and (max-width:400px){.home-half-slider .option-panel,.fs-slider-wrap .option-panel{width:60px}.start-btn.hero-start,.home-half-slider .start-btn{color:transparent}.home-half-slider .start-btn:before,.start-btn.hero-start:before{content:"\f178";font-family:Font\ Awesome\ 5\ Pro;color:#fff;left:20px;position:relative}.start-btn.hero-start{width:83px}.scroll-down-wrap{margin-left:0}.vc-section .section-number.right_sn{display:none}.hero-start-link a{width:100px}}@media only screen and (max-width:1064px){.section-number.right_sn{display:none}}.wr-mar-top{margin-top:40px}.wp-block-button__link{padding:0 45px;outline:none;border:none;cursor:pointer;-webkit-appearance:none;height:44px;line-height:44px;float:left;position:relative;color:#fff;font-size:10px;text-transform:uppercase;letter-spacing:2px;font-weight:400;margin:25px 0 15px}.has-lightning-yellow-background-color{background-color:#f9bf26}.has-lightning-yellow-color{color:#f9bf26}.has-color-black-color{color:#000}.has-color-black-background-color{background-color:#000}.has-small-font-size{font-size:11px}.has-large-font-size{font-size:36px;line-height:35px}.has-huge-font-size{line-height:35px}.left-panel_social li{text-align:center}.tp-kbimg{left:0}.jr-insta-thumb{float:left;width:100%}.jr-insta-thumb a{float:left;width:33.3%;padding:5px;overflow:hidden;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.jr-insta-thumb a img{width:100%;height:auto}.post strong,p strong{font-weight:700}.widget_theside_footer_logo_widget .footer-header{display:none}.single-side-bar .nav-search input{border-bottom:1px solid #2d2d32;color:#2d2d32}.single-side-bar .nav-search #submit_btn{color:#2d2d32}.widget .nav-search{padding-left:0}.woocommerce-product-details__short-description ul{float:left;width:100%;margin-bottom:20px}.woocommerce-product-details__short-description ul li{float:left;font-size:12px;line-height:24px;padding-bottom:10px;font-weight:500;color:#5e646a;text-align:left}.woocommerce-product-details__short-description ul li strong{font-weight:700;padding-right:5px}.woocommerce-MyAccount-navigation,.woocommerce-MyAccount-content{padding:10% 0%}.woocommerce-MyAccount-navigation ul li{float:left;width:100%;padding:10px 0;text-align:left;color:rgba(255,255,255,.41);text-transform:uppercase;letter-spacing:2px;word-spacing:0;font-size:10px}.woocommerce-MyAccount-navigation ul li a{color:rgba(255,255,255,.41)}.woocommerce-MyAccount-navigation ul{float:left;width:100%;padding:30px 45px;background:#2a2a2e}.woocommerce-account .woocommerce-MyAccount-content{font-size:12px;line-height:24px;padding-bottom:10px;font-weight:500;color:#5e646a;text-align:left}@media only screen and (max-width:500px){.woocommerce ul.products[class*="columns-"] li.product,.woocommerce-page ul.products[class*="columns-"] li.product{width:100%}.port-search form{max-width:350px}}.port-search{top:150px!important}.port-search h3,.port-search p{color:#fff}@media only screen and (max-width:640px){.footer-widget{float:left;width:100%}}